数学建模·市场投资的收益和风险模型

上传人:第** 文档编号:36943637 上传时间:2018-04-04 格式:DOC 页数:11 大小:358.88KB
返回 下载 相关 举报
数学建模·市场投资的收益和风险模型_第1页
第1页 / 共11页
数学建模·市场投资的收益和风险模型_第2页
第2页 / 共11页
数学建模·市场投资的收益和风险模型_第3页
第3页 / 共11页
数学建模·市场投资的收益和风险模型_第4页
第4页 / 共11页
数学建模·市场投资的收益和风险模型_第5页
第5页 / 共11页
点击查看更多>>
资源描述

《数学建模·市场投资的收益和风险模型》由会员分享,可在线阅读,更多相关《数学建模·市场投资的收益和风险模型(11页珍藏版)》请在金锄头文库上搜索。

1、1市场投资的收益和风险模型摘要本文提出了一个多目标规划的数学模型,解决了市场投资方案的问题,使收益值 尽可能大,风险值尽可能小。 为了方便求解,我们把非线性的转化为线性的,并将两个目标函数用加权系数法, 引入加权系数,转化为一个目标函数,其中反应的是风险水平。另外,在考虑交易费 时,由于有个最小给定值的约束使问题很复杂,为了简化,我们将问题简化为只考虑 超过部分的交易费,这样也利于求解。最后,由 MATLAB 求解出问题的最佳抉择与收 益及其风险表: 问题一的投资组合方案如下:00.030.040.050.20.2111S0.00000.00000.00001.00002S0.99010.36

2、900.23760.00003S0.00000.61500.39600.00004S0.00000.00000.10800.0000投资银行0.00000.00000.22840.0000收益0.26730.21650.20160.0005风险0.02480.01850.02380.0000问题二给出了投资收益与风险的一般模型:0 0 1max ()niii ifm rpm rmin g=maxiimq0 1(1)1. 01nii iimpmst m 再将带入模型,按问题一相同思路得出投资组合方案(具体方案见文中) 。15n 关键词:关键词:多目标规划 加权系数法 市场投资2一、问题的重述市场

3、上有 n 种资产(如股票、债券、)供投资者选择,某公司有数), 1(niSiL额为的一笔相当大的资金可用作一个时期的投资。公司财务分析人员对这 n 种资产M进行了评估,估算出这在这一时期内购买的平均收益率为,并预测出购买的风iSiriS险损失率。考虑到投资越分散,总的风险越小,公司确定,当用这笔资金购买若干iq种资产时,总体风险可用所投资的中最大的一个风险来度量。iS购买要付交易费,费率为,并且当购买额不超过给定值时,交易费按购买iSipiu计算(不买当然无须付费) 。另外,假定同期银行存款利率是, 且既无交易费又无iu0r风险。 (=5%) 0r1、已知 n = 4 时的由给出的相关数据,试

4、给该公司设计一种投资组合方案,即用给定 的资金,有选择地购买若干种资产或存银行生息,使净收益尽可能大,而总体风险尽 可能小。 2、试就一般情况对以上问题进行讨论,并利用给出数据进行计算。二、模型的假设1、假设确定相当大,这一条件可以在交易额很小时,忽略交易费;M 2、假设投资越分散,总的风险越小,且总体风险可用所投资的资产当中最大的一个风 险来度量; 3、假设交易费按购买计算,在不买的情形下当然无须付费; 4、假设同期银行存款利率保持定值不变,且既无交易费又无风险。三、符号的约定市场资产数目;:n市场资产的种类(其中表示投资银行) ;:iS0S选择投资的资金比例(其中表示投资银行的资金比例)

5、;:imiS0m购买的平均收益率;:iriS购买的风险损失率;:iqiS购买的交易费率:ipiS3交易费用;:iU交易额较低时的交易费用;:iu总给定的投资资金;:M净收益额;:f总体风险。:g四、模型的建立与求解(一)问题一的分析、模型的建立与求解(一)问题一的分析、模型的建立与求解 1、问题的分析、问题的分析 该问题为一个多目标规划问题,即要提出一种投资方案,既要收益尽可能大,又要让风险最小。在投资每一种资金的同时,都有着相应的一组数据对应,即收益率 ir,风险损失率,交易费率。对于银行来说,。但在考虑交易iqip0005%,0,0rqp费时需要分段考虑:0 0;.iiiiiiiiMmUu

6、MmuMmMmu 在考虑总体风险时,我们要求值最小,而风险又是在所有投资项目中最大的一个 风险来度量,即要求在风险的最大值中找到一组最小值解,实际为一极小极大值问题。 两者是对立矛盾的,就要我们在两者之间找到一个合适的投资方案让问题求解。 2、模型的建立、模型的建立 建立多目标规划函数:40 0 1max ()i iii ifMmrU pMm rmin g=maxiiMmq约束条件:4401. 0,01iii iiiiMmU pMst Um 3、模型的求解、模型的求解 对于该模型的求解,是比较复杂的,直接求解几乎找不到方法,我们只好将问题 进行化简处理,试探求解。 问题的复杂在于交易费有个最小

7、给定值的约束,我们如果有一部分投资额低于给 定值时,问题将十分麻烦,将对 4 种投资各进行两次判断是否达到最低给定值,那么总共的情况就有种。在投资额都超过最低给定值的这种情况下的交易费: 8225644411103*0.01+198*0.02+52*0.045+40*0.065=9.9300iii iiUUpu显然数据很小,我们可以忽略掉。在最好的一种方便的情况下,就是 4 中投资额 都超过最低给定值,将使问题清晰,一目了然。然而在假设中为相当大,我们就更M 有理由将交易费低于给定值的情形忽略,将问题简化为只考虑超过部分的交易费。重 新列出为:0 ;.ii i iiiMmuUMmMmu此时把当

8、作一个单位量,于是,M40 0 1max ()iii ifm rpm rmin g=maxiimq40 1(1)1. 01ii iimpmst m 现在问题还是比较复杂,我们将两个目标函数用加权系数法,引入加权系数。 转化为一个目标函数:min (1) ()Fgf 01反应的是风险水平,时投资者只顾收益不顾风险,这样,收益可能达到最大,0 但是风险也达到最大;时投资者总是担心风险,不会考虑收益,这样就会把投资1 全部放在银行。 对于第二个目标函数,是一个非线性的,解决十分麻烦,但是该式总有一个最大值,则有,于是可以把该式转化为一个约束条件让问题简便。5m5iimqm450 0 1min (1)

9、 ()iii iFmm rpm r40 15(1)1.0 1,401ii iiiimpmst mqmim L上述线性规划模型,容易由 MATLAB 优化工具箱的 linprog 线性规划函数求出解。我们取,编程搜索求解得到最佳抉择与收益及其风险见表 1:0,0.1,0.2,1L表 1:投资组合方案(见附录程序一)00.030.040.050.20.21151S0.00000.00000.00001.00002S0.99010.36900.23760.00003S0.00000.61500.39600.00004S0.00000.00000.10800.0000投资银行0.00000.00000

10、.22840.0000收益0.26730.21650.20160.0005风险0.02480.01850.02380.00004、问题的结果、问题的结果 投资组合表中的收益与风险值之间的关系见图 1:0.050.10.150.20.250.300.0050.010.0150.020.025收 收收 收图 1:收益与风险值关系 可以看出,在收益增大的同时,风险也在增大。这符合一般生活的规律。而由图 也可以看出,在风险为 0 的情形下,收益值为 0.05,此时刚好正是全部投资银行的收 益值。(二)问题二的分析、模型的建立与求解(二)问题二的分析、模型的建立与求解 1、问题的分析、问题的分析 本问题

11、要求给出一般情况的讨论,实际上,在问题一的基础上我们很容易归结出 该模型的一般情况。即将上面建立的模型中的 4 换为 n 即可。相同的,我们还是当作 很大的时候,交易费很低时,U 值可以忽略,使问题简化。M 2、模型的建立、模型的建立 由分析可以写出模型的一般情况:60 0 1max ()niii ifm rpm rmin g=maxiimq0 1(1)1. 01nii iimpmst m 上述问题仍然采用问题一的思想,运用加权系数法将多目标规划转为单一目标线性规 划问题:10 0 1min (1) ()nniii iFmm rpm r 0 11(1)1.0 1,01nii iiinimpms

12、t mqminm L3、模型的求解、模型的求解 对于一般情形下的,下面进行计算。15n 由于一般情形中假设投资额较小时,可以忽略,验证该情况下的交易费:151511=181.6730iii iiUUpu可以看出,对于相当大的 M,该值不计时符合的。运用相同的方法计算得到最佳抉择 与收益及其风险见表 2:表 2:时的投资组合方案(见附录程序二)15n 00.010.020.03 0.040.05 0.060.070.080.090.111S0.00000.00000.00000.00000.00000.00000.05180.00002S0.00000.00000.00000.00000.045

13、30.04250.04030.00003S0.94340.04980.04560.04270.04070.03830.03620.00004S0.00000.00000.00000.06110.05820.05470.05180.00005S0.00000.00000.00000.00000.00000.00000.00000.00006S0.00000.00000.00000.00000.00000.05890.05580.000077S0.00000.04390.04020.03770.03590.03380.03200.00008S0.00000.00000.08180.07680.07

14、320.06870.06510.00009S0.00000.05600.05130.04810.04590.04310.04080.000010S0.00000.07460.06830.06410.06110.05740.05440.000011S0.00000.00000.00000.00000.00000.00000.00000.000012S0.00000.00000.00000.00000.00000.00000.00000.000013S0.00000.74640.68340.64110.61110.57390.54360.000014S0.00000.00000.00000.000

15、00.00000.00000.00000.000015S0.00000.00000.00000.00000.00000.00000.00000.0000存银行0.00000.00000.00000.00000.00000.00000.00001.0000净收益0.40940.32070.31660.31070.30310.29090.27940.0500风险值0.56600.02990.02730.02560.02440.02300.02170.00004、问题的结果、问题的结果 上表中投资组合表中的收益与风险值之间的关系见图 2:0.050.10.150.20.250.30.350.40.4500.10.20.30.40.50.60.7收 收收 收图 2:时收益与风险关系15n 由图可以看到,收益值增加的同时,风险也在增大。我们可以通过简单的曲线拟 合来建立收益风险函数,找到最优情况下的组合。8五、模型的检验与灵敏度分析1、实用性分析、实用性分析我们在简化模型的时候,是在的前提下给出解集的,也就是要满足每一项iiMmu投资:。对于这个条件,由于给出值一般较小,充分大,是容易满足的。i iumMiuM但是我们的模型在时,给出的解就不再时最优解。0i iumM2、

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 行业资料 > 教育/培训

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号